Shadowing is an advanced language learning technique, which can be used by learners independently to improve their intonation and pronunciation. It's quite a simple concept - you listen to a model (i.e. a video or audio of someone speaking) and you repeat what they say in real time.

โThe two pie charts illustrate the usage of energy by typical Australian families, as well as the proportion of greenhouse gases this energy consumption produces.
Overall, there seems to be little connection (wit the exception of cooling) between the energy consumption of different appliances and the resulting emissions. Most of the energy is expended on heating the house, but the largest share of greenhouse gasses is produced from water heating.
The least energy-intense activity on the chart is cooling (2%), which accounts for 3% of total emissions. In contrast, heating accounts for the largest consumption of energy at 42%, followed by water heating responsible of 30% of energy use. Regarding greenhouse gas emissions, however, the pattern is the opposite, with water heating producing the biggest share of emissions at 32%.
Refrigeration and lighting require very little energy, 7 and 4% respectively. In terms of emissions, refrigeration is just 1% behind heating, which emits 15% of overall greenhouse gases. Other appliances are responsible for 15% of energy consumption, but they produce 27% of all the emissions. (177 words)
